To be a really cheap. Another word for mooch.
That girl is the biggest chup I know, she wouldn't even buy a drink when we went out, but made us all share ours.
#cheap #chupp #mooch #cheap ass #tight wad #miser #scrooge
by Chuppppperson March 19, 2011
